Frequently Asked Questions about College Station

What type of rentals are currently available in College Station?

There are currently 351 Apartments for Rent in College Station, TX with pricing that ranges from $399 to $24,168. There are also 436 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in College Station ranging from $475 to $13,000.

What is the current price range for Rental Homes in College Station?

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in College Station ranges from $475 to $13,000 with an average monthly rent of $3,649.

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in College Station?

For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in College Station range from $624 to $10,707,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,350 to $3,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$500 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$399.
